@MizbaSayyed scanning QR Code is an optional check that the user can perform. So long as invoice is Reported / Cleared successfully all requirements are fulfilled from VAT Regulations and E-Invoicing requirements perspective. That said, please be assured that relevant teams are assessing the ways to enable scanning outside KSA.
